| /* |
| * What all of this mess does is: |
| * 1. Launch Xvfb on the next available DISPLAY. Xvfb reports the |
| * display number to an fd passed with -displayfd once it's |
| * initialized. We pass a pipe there to read it. |
| * 2. Make an xcb connection to this display. |
| * 3. Launch xkbcomp to change the keymap of the new display (doing |
| * this programmatically is major work [which we may yet do some |
| * day for xkbcommon-x11] so we use xkbcomp for now). |
| * 4. Download the keymap back from the display using xkbcommon-x11. |
| * 5. Compare received keymap to the uploaded keymap. |
| * 6. Kill the server & clean up. |
| */ |
